What companies run services between Bristol Temple Meads, England and Delft, Netherlands?

You can take a train from Bristol Temple Meads to Delft via London Paddington, Paddington, King's Cross St. Pancras station, London St. Pancras Int., and Rotterdam Centraal in around 6h 35m. Alternatively, you can take a vehicle from Bristol Temple Meads to Delft via Temple Meads Stn, Union Street, Bus Station, London Victoria, Rotterdam Central Station, and Rotterdam Centraal in around 14h 20m.
